"My father asked a family friend who is a watchmaker to assemble a watch from parts sourced from his supplier (like an ETA movement, or things like that) in order for my father to offer it to me as a gift. Later on I discovered the brand "Molnar Fabry" and purchased a Piece Unique from them. Seeing that they're creating and making lots of watch parts completely by hand themselves, I began to seriously dream that they could upgrade the watch my father gifted to me by maybe adding a new hand made and hand engraved dial, or new set of hand made hands, etc. So I asked them about this, and they agreed.
So by the time my official Piece Unique was to be ready and completed, I sent them my watch, and they upgraded it beautifully with lots of new things. But as this watch was my own, and they only added some new components on it, they couldn't sign it. That's why their name is not put on the finished watch. But you can still see their DNA in it. And I want to add that, last year I bought a 2nd Piece Unique from Molnar Fabry and jumped at the opportunity to ask them for a few more upgrades. So the watch now has a new skeletonized barrel design and new finishing on the key-less work. And it was serviced at that time last year too when they upgraded it for the second time."
